Pros: beachfront property, within walking distance of lots of shops and restaurants, good view of the beach, good housekeeping, comfortable bed.
Cons: very outdated rooms and dirty carpets, you never know what you’re gonna get with the staff sometimes they’re friendly and sometimes they’re rude, it was very unclear about parking and what fees you were going to have to pay.
We booked here and had our trip paid for before we arrived. We were aware that there were going to be additional resort fees that we would have to pay upon arrival which we paid. But we were unaware that in order to have your own rental car you would be required to pay $54 a day for parking with the valet (mandatory valet; $75 for oversized vehicles). When we checked in the lady at the front counter was very friendly, but the valet most of the time seemed unfriendly and annoyed with helping anyone. Just be aware that if you are staying here, you will end up paying 54+ dollars per day to park, and there is almost no accessible/affordable parking in the nearby area that you can circumvent this problem. The bed was pretty comfortable, but there are no fans or anything in the rooms and you could kind of smell that they had mildew growing. The carpets were also very dirty; they were vacuumed, but you could tell that they needed to be cleaned. And pretty much everything is very outdated, but it all worked properly. It is within walking distance of the beach and lots of the nearby businesses which was nice.
